On the pour, Haiku de Saison is a cloudy, pale yellow color with a lot of tiny carbonation bubbles and a thin white head. It has a grassy aroma with some yeasty funkiness. It is very Belgian in flavor, bready with hints of banana and clove. There is also a substantial amount of tartness which adds a completely separate aspect, adding to the complexity. Pale yellow color
Bready banana and clove
With complex tartness
